Patent number: 9729902Abstract: A system includes a session and resource manager and a video pump. The session and resource manager negotiates encryption keys from a headend controller and provides the encryption keys to a video pump. The video pump uses the encryption keys from the session and resource manager to encrypt content. Thus, the video pump uses encryption keys to encrypt the content so that it is encrypted right from the video pump prior to transmission over the entire transport system. Patent number: 9591337Abstract: Reducing head end server demand for cable television/services systems with point-to-point Media on Demand content delivery is provided. Upon receiving a request for media content, a content table may be requested from one or more neighboring network-connected devices to search for the requested content. If the requested content is found, the content may be provided to the requesting device from the neighboring device. If the requested content is not found on a neighboring device, a hub server station may be queried for the requested media content. The media content may be provided by the head end server if the content is not available on a neighboring device or the hub server. Embodiments may reduce demand on the head end server and free the head end server capacity for other uses.Type: GrantFiled: March 27, 2012Date of Patent: March 7, 2017Assignee: Cox Communications, Inc.Inventor: Michael A. Publication number: 20170064419Abstract: Example embodiments of a time division duplex (TDD) Wavelength Division Multiplex Passive Optical Network (WDM PON) architecture using passive optical splitters are disclosed herein. The disclosed TDD WDM PON includes fixed wavelength optical transmitters in an Optical Line Termination system with tunable receiver colorless Optical Network Units (ONUs) that reuse the downstream CW light to carry upstream data. The same wavelength may be used for downstream and upstream transmissions on a single fiber in the ODN. In this architecture, the number of ONUs may be greater than the number of transmitters at the OLT, allowing for a highly scalable system with capacity for growth.
